Hi,

At times our datastage project just hangs. We are not able to do anything, not even reset the aborted jobs. We clear the &PH& directory by CLEAR.FILE command and everything is normal.
1. Is it standard pratice to use CLEAR.FILE for clearing &PH&? If not what is the alternative?
2. Is there any check list we can maintain for regular house keeping? Basically what are the different things we need to keep track off for good administration of the project?
3. Do we have any best practice document for these things?

any help on this is appreciated.

1. Yes. Alternative is delete entries more than x days old.

2. Purge job logs. Clean up unneeded files in UVTEMP directory.

3. No.
